WebbIn the case of a spider trap, when the random walker reaches the node 1 in the above example, he can only jump to node 2 and from node 2, he can only reach node 1, and so on. The importance of all other nodes will be taken by nodes 1 and 2. In the above example, the probability distribution will converge to π = (0, 0.5, 0.5, 0). The one-dimensional random walk is constructed as follows: You walk along a line, each pace being the same length. Before each step, you flip a coin. If it’s heads, you take one step forward. If it’s tails, you take one step back. The coin is unbiased, so the chances of heads or tails are equal.

Webb25 mars 2024 · random walk, in probability theory, a process for determining the probable location of a point subject to random motions, given the probabilities (the same at each step) of moving some distance in some direction. Random walks are an example of Markov processes, in which future behaviour is independent of past history. A typical example is …

WebbThe random walker algorithm [1] is based on anisotropic diffusion from seeded pixels, where the local diffusivity is a decreasing function of the image gradient. Random walker segmentation is more robust to "leaky" boundaries than watershed segmentation. [1] Grady, L. (2006).
